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
59796558384 96 54834 20995413323 0513602
984258614 6803
984258614 6803
36046 011718 80
All about undefined
Interested in learning more?
984258614 6803
36046 011718 80
See more
0417 7614945 440
645 700088048 520854109
See more
10214713 95452
742642 486518939 949139 06819
See more